Strategic Communications and Support for the
 Second Strategic Highway Research Program

U.S. DOT, Volpe National Transportation Systems Center | Sponsored by FHWA

 

MacroSys provided strategic communications support for the Federal Highway Administration’s (FHWA) Second Strategic Highway Research Program (SHRP2) as part of a job order under a complex, multi-year, multi-million dollar IDIQ contract with the Volpe National Transportation Systems Center. The program was authorized by Congress to deliver ground-breaking products to help the transportation industry save lives, money, and time through advancements to improve the reliability, capacity, renewal, and safety of the Nation’s highway network. MacroSys assisted with pre-implementation support services, including program planning and management, strategic communication (i.e., branding and marketing), and website development. MacroSys also conducted stakeholder interviews with key automobile, safety, insurance, planning, and transit leaders to guide the strategy and nationwide strategic communications plan.

 

Due to SHRP2’s evolving nature fueled by its rolling deliverables, MacroSys developed a flexible strategy that changed over time to achieve the program’s goals. Currently, the SHRP2 website, which was created as part of this initiative, is the centerpiece in building the SHRP2 community across the country. MacroSys supported a steering committee consisting of over 20 members in the development of a unified brand and message platform, as seen in the nationally recognized SHRP2 tag line: Safe lives. Safe money. Save time.
